]> git.proxmox.com Git - mirror_edk2.git/blob - MdeModulePkg/Library/VariablePolicyLib/VariablePolicyExtraInitNull.c
UefiCpuPkg: Move AsmRelocateApLoopStart from Mpfuncs.nasm to AmdSev.nasm
[mirror_edk2.git] / MdeModulePkg / Library / VariablePolicyLib / VariablePolicyExtraInitNull.c
1 /** @file -- VariablePolicyExtraInitNull.c
2 This file contains extra init and deinit routines that don't do anything
3 extra.
4
5 Copyright (c) Microsoft Corporation.
6 SPDX-License-Identifier: BSD-2-Clause-Patent
7
8 **/
9
10 #include <Library/UefiRuntimeServicesTableLib.h>
11
12 /**
13 An extra init hook that enables the RuntimeDxe library instance to
14 register VirtualAddress change callbacks. Among other things.
15
16 @retval EFI_SUCCESS Everything is good. Continue with init.
17 @retval Others Uh... don't continue.
18
19 **/
20 EFI_STATUS
21 VariablePolicyExtraInit (
22 VOID
23 )
24 {
25 // NULL implementation.
26 return EFI_SUCCESS;
27 }
28
29 /**
30 An extra deinit hook that enables the RuntimeDxe library instance to
31 register VirtualAddress change callbacks. Among other things.
32
33 @retval EFI_SUCCESS Everything is good. Continue with deinit.
34 @retval Others Uh... don't continue.
35
36 **/
37 EFI_STATUS
38 VariablePolicyExtraDeinit (
39 VOID
40 )
41 {
42 // NULL implementation.
43 return EFI_SUCCESS;
44 }